When in a car accident, write down what happened as soon as you are safe to do so. For example, what you were doing when it happened, how you are hurt, what damage there is to your car, what damage there is to the other car, and what you think caused the accident or how the other driver was at fault.

Contact the authorities asap if you've suffered a personal injury. If an accident occurs while you are at work, make sure that you report it to your supervisor immediately. You should make sure you call the police right away if you find yourself part of an automobile accident.

Hire a lawyer located where the court your personal injury trial will be playing out is located. This ensures they can easily get to the court for your dates, plus they know the local laws and understand them to a "T". They may also be familiar with the judges and their personalities, which can benefit your case.

If your personal injuries are minor, you probably do not want to hire a personal injury lawyer. The medical costs of something like a bruised leg would not justify the expense of hiring an attorney. In those cases, try to work things out with the other party amicably, or take them to small claims court.

After an accident, don't move your car unless the police tell you to. Moving the car can lead to more damage, leaving you at least partially liable. This isn't the case in a busy street, however.

Carefully read legal advertisements of personal-injury lawyers to determine the legitimacy of the practice. Sometimes, a lawyer will guarantee that they will win for you when this is an impossible situation to predict. Skip over these lawyers as they are simply trying to reel you in for the money you bring to the table.

If you are seeking a personal injury attorney, consult with an attorney that you already know and trust. If you have someone who has represented you in a real estate transaction or drawn up a will for you, that is a good starting place. While this person might not take personal injury cases, he might be able to refer you to a trusted colleague who does.

Make sure to take pictures of any vehicles that were involved in an accident. Take them from different angles so there are no issues later. If people claim that damages were done that were not, you will have solid proof that what they are saying is not what really happened.
